Fake cigarettes seized April 18, 2021 Rawalpindi : Two truckloads of six million counterfeit cigarettes were seized by the Federal Board of Revenue [FBR] on Expressway Murree near Lower Topa, causing a loss of over Rs12 million to the national exchequer in federal excise duty and sales tax. A team of the Regional Tax Office, Rawalpindi intercepted two trucks carrying 300 packarites of counterfeited brand ‘Classic’ and 300 packarites of counterfeited brand ‘Kissan’ on Expressway Murree near Lower Topa. The counterfeit cigarettes were manufactured in the Wayward factory in Muzaffarabad owned by Babar Taj and Babar Naseem and were being transported to other parts of the country when seized in a raid. Lawyers, members of the civil society and students have protested many times in Muzaffarabad against the factory, but the government has yet to initiate action against it. ....
